Details

Obverse: Nepali text; King Birendra in royal dress and plumed crown; Rama-Janaki temple of Janakpur; obverse of coin

Reverse: English and Nepali text; male Hemitragus jemlahicus (tahr); mountains; bank logo; coat of arms
